<h2>What is QVC?</h2>
<p>QVC is one of the largest multimedia retailers in the world, and broadcast live 24 hours a day, 364 days of the year. This is the live show that sells the products constructed by the worlds entrepreneurs in a quick hitting, in your face, shop at home style.</p>
<p>According to their website, QVC is a wholly owned subsidiary </p>
<p>of Liberty Media Corporation attributed to the Liberty Interactive Group. Trades under the Nasdaq as LINTA. QVC was founded in 1986 by Joesph Segal. In it&#8217;s first full fiscal year of business, QVC&#8217;s revenues exceeded $122 million. This is outstanding and was a record in American business history for sales of a new public company.</p>
<p>Additional information on the QVC website reveals the company received more than 181 million phone calls last in the United States alone, shipped 166 million units worldwide. Net sales for 2007 was more than $7 billion and they reach more than 166 million cable and satellite homes worldwide.</p>

<h2>Marketing Lessons from QVC</h2>
<p><strong><span style="text-decoration: underline;">1) Prominent Product Positioning.</span></strong> Although they are only limited to your television screen, the QVC administrators have mastered art of prominently placing their products on the screen to maximize visibility and give the potential buyers an idea of how big the product is they are viewing and how it is used. This is done by showing the product next to common items in the home or someones hand to give an idea of size. And they are always demonstrating the use of the products as well as giving suggestions on how it can be used by the end buyers.</p>
<p><strong><span style="text-decoration: underline;">2) Repetition of your message and selling points.</span></strong> Repetition seems to be one of the key strategies that QVC employs to move their products. And moving their products is their specialty. Watching the show on pillows, they sold over 52,000 units while I was watching the show. Simply amazing! And one of the key points I noticed during this segment was how many times and variety of different ways they repeated the product name and unique selling points. The lesson for you is to make your offering visible and repeat the benefits as often as you can without driving the customer or readers crazy. The point is you have to get your message into their minds so they can realize this is something they need. This can only be done through repetition.</p>
<p><span><br />
</span></p>
<p><img class="size-medium wp-image-889 alignright" style="margin-top: 5px; margin-bottom: 5px; margin-left: 10px; margin-right: 10px;" title="qvc" src="http://freddietaylor.com/wp-content/images/2009/02/qvc-277x300.png" alt="" width="277" height="300" /></p>
<p><strong><span style="text-decoration: underline;">3) Urgency.</span> </strong>I love the way QVC uses urgency to convert sales. Yes, they spokes person does let you know that this is a limited time only offer. But the subtle way they do it is the best&#8230;.with the clock. They will have a countdown clock in the corner of screen letting the viewers know that this product will only be available for the next 5 minutes, so they better act now. Another way they utilize this tactic is by saying there is is only 1,000 of these units available and they show how many are left in stock. Again, emphasizing the urgency the viewer needs to use to get one of these great deals. In your business, maybe you could have time sensitive dates for your readers or customers to act on to take advantage of your offerings.</p>
<p><strong><span style="text-decoration: underline;">4) Appeal to Desire to Belong.</span></strong> I had trouble naming this, but it works. The point I am trying to illustrate is they use of &#8220;everyone else is doing it, so you should as well&#8221; tactic utilized by the QVC. Example, on the screen they would flash how many orders have been sold. As mentioned above, during the sale of the pillows they kept flashing the number of sales they have made. This was done for urgency because they said only so many units would be sold, but also to let people know that others have found this to be a great buy. Sometimes as entrepreneurs and bloggers, we utilize this tactic in the form of testimonials, which QVC does as well with live callers that are buying the products. They allow the presenters to interview them after making a purchase. The viewer identifies with the buyer and thinks maybe this will be a good deal for them as well. The desire to belong is great in a many of our markets, so consider using this tool at your disposal as well.</p>
<p><strong><span style="text-decoration: underline;">5) Show Savings.</span></strong> Regardless of the market and especially today, people are looking for a savings. You should not allow the consumers to calculate the savings they will benefit from buying your product or service. QVC does this with the side bar on the screen where they will show the retail price of an item, the marked down price, and the difference is the saving. In addition, they will have specials if someone bought two items, then they would get the second one for $5 off. Instead of just letting this savings slide, they would highlight that and encourage the buyers to get two in order to save more money. The more they buy, the more they save. It is a great way to get your potential buyers one step closer to making a purchase with you.</p>
<p><strong><span style="text-decoration: underline;">6) Make Purchase Recommendations.</span></strong>  As mentioned in #5, QVC will make various packages that the buyers can choose from and illustrate the savings involved. This is a great idea, but don&#8217;t loss the other recommendation in there. The opportunity to tell your audience what they need. QVC was selling pillows in sets of two, but encourage the viewers to buy two sets of two pillows for the savings, their spouse, even the guest bedroom. If you can build your ethos, trust, with your audience, then they will believe you and take your council in purchase decisions.</p>
<p><strong><span style="text-decoration: underline;">7) Connect Features &amp; Benefits to Buyer Needs.</span> </strong>You are aware that QVC utilized spokespeople to promote the products during the individual segments. The people are not talking aimlessly about the products they are selling, but they strategically mentioning the features and benefits of each item and drawing a directly relationship to the needs of their buyers. As an example, the pillows were to provide great support for the users and this point was demonstrated by having someone lie on their pillow and a regular store bought pillow. Once this demonstration was made and you could clearly see the difference in the two pillows, the presenters spent a lot of time telling the viewers how and why this will benefit them and solve their needs. Everything from the quality of the pillow will save you money because you will buy less, to the better nights rest and refreshed feeling you will spring out of bed was covered. Your buyers will not buy if they don&#8217;t understand how your product will help them out specifically. Spend time driving that point home.</p>
<p><span style="text-decoration: underline;"><strong><a href="http://freddietaylor.com/wp-content/images/2009/02/qvc-website.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-880" style="margin-top: 5px; margin-bottom: 5px; margin-left: 10px; margin-right: 10px;" title="qvc-website" src="http://freddietaylor.com/wp-content/images/2009/02/qvc-website-300x212.jpg" alt="" /></a>8 ) Easy, Visible Purchase Options.</strong></span> If you watch QVC, there is no doubt that you can find out how to purchase their goods. First of all, the spokesperson is going to mention how you can do this every so often, but it is also plastered all over the screen. They have the phone number visible (large) and the website clearly visible. They let their viewers know exactly how they can pay for the goods, by credit card, eCheck, PayPal, but not C.O.D. It is very important to never leave your potential buyers guessing. Every delay is a moment for them to turn away and entertain someone else&#8217;s offer. Don&#8217;t give them that chance, provide them the information they need to make a purchase decision.</p>

<p><strong>So how does the entrepreneur get that accountability they need? </strong></p>
<p>They have to go get it. You can get a mentor. This is a great idea. That mentor would be better than a boss because there are there to help you learn and grow. Mentors have been a key asset of successful people for centuries. Don&#8217;t neglect the power.</p>
<p>You could network with a group of like minded people that will hold you accountable. You have to network and meet people that you respect enough to work with them and trust them enough to share your goals and dreams with them. Everyone in this group could share the ir weekly or monthly goals and hold each other accountable for their goals. Moral support and not letting the group down can be powerful motivators for you.</p>
